I bought two of these as a matching pair on either side of a sofa. I am not keeping either. They each came unassembled in two halves connected by the electrical cord. It is a simple assembly to screw in the two parts. However, one lamp the cord was severed. I don't know if it was a manufacturer or shipping problem. The other issue I have is the place where it screws together. It doesn't form a seamless edge so you can see a very small ring of unpainted area. Not a big problem but for the price it should look better. I also thought these were wood and they are not - appear to be some sort of resin. Another negative isthe lampshade is nice but way too short. It gives the lamp (which is very tall) an odd look. If I kept it I would replace the shade with a 3-4" longer drum shade. Lastly, the paint just looks shabby - not chic. I bought these for a beach house and thought they would give it a nice coastal look. It looks horrible. The only positive is they are more substantial in length and width than most floor lamps.
